2008 Mercedes-Benz G vs. 2008 Citroen Xsara
To start off, both 2008 Mercedes-Benz G and 2008 Citroen Xsara were released in the same year (2008). Therefore the support and the availability on parts for both vehicles should be relatively similar. At 5,439 cc (8 cylinders), 2008 Mercedes-Benz G is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2008 Mercedes-Benz G (493 HP) has 385 more horse power than 2008 Citroen Xsara. (108 HP). In normal driving conditions, 2008 Mercedes-Benz G should accelerate faster than 2008 Citroen Xsara.
Because 2008 Mercedes-Benz G is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2008 Citroen Xsara.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2008 Mercedes-Benz G will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2008 Mercedes-Benz G (700 Nm @ 2800 RPM) has 553 more torque (in Nm) than 2008 Citroen Xsara. (147 Nm @ 4000 RPM). This means 2008 Mercedes-Benz G will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2008 Citroen Xsara.
Compare all specifications:
2008 Mercedes-Benz G | 2008 Citroen Xsara | |
Make | Mercedes-Benz | Citroen |
Model | G | Xsara |
Year Released | 2008 | 2008 |
Body Type | SUV | Hatchback |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 5439 cc | 1585 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 8 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 3 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 493 HP | 108 HP |
Torque | 700 Nm | 147 Nm |
Torque RPM | 2800 RPM | 4000 RPM |
Drive Type | 4WD | Front |
Transmission Type | Automatic | Automatic |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 5 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Length | 4720 mm | 4380 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1870 mm | 1710 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1980 mm | 1430 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2860 mm | 2550 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 96 L | 54 L |
